Deep Dive into the Effects of the POD HD Multi-Effects Processors: Echo Platter
Jul 26, 2011 Line 6 General, Line 6 Tips & Tricks
The Echo Platter delay model on the POD HD multi-effect processors is a very special effect indeed. It is based on one of the most sought-after and revered delay effects of all time, the Binson Echorec. Brief History of Binson The very first Echorec units were introduced in the late 1950s. What is reamping and how do I reamp?
Feb 19, 2010 Line 6 Tips & Tricks
Reamping is a technique that allows you to capture a dry (unprocessed) guitar signal so that later, if you decide you want to change your tone, you can alter the signal processing without having to replay the guitar parts.
